Reducing Back Pain at Work: 6 Ergonomic Tips

March 14, 2026

Work-related back pain is common, especially when long sitting, repetitive lifting, or poor posture are involved.

1. Keep your screen at eye level

This reduces neck and upper-back strain.

2. Support your lower back

Use a lumbar support or cushion to maintain neutral spine posture.

3. Take movement breaks every 30 to 45 minutes

Brief standing and mobility breaks can reduce stiffness.

4. Lift with your legs, not your back

Use controlled movements and avoid twisting while lifting.

5. Adjust your workstation height

Shoulders should stay relaxed and elbows near 90 degrees.

6. Build core and hip strength

Corrective exercises support better movement and reduce reinjury risk.

If pain is ongoing, professional assessment can help identify the root cause and guide treatment.
